My sketchup is constantly freezing

Yesterday my Sketchup Pro 2018 was working fine, and now today I cannot even save a file without the app freezing. It never unfreezes (I have waited up to one hour) and I’ve had to force quit. It has been happening across the board with complex and simple models. I have not changed any settings (that I know of) between yesterday and today.

I tried uninstalling and reinstalling, and no luck. It is still freezing. Any help or advice is greatly appreciated!

If you have some extensions, disable them all in extensions manager and check if the problem occurs again

Ok, I think that worked- thank you so much. I installed a PDF Exporter plugin a few days ago, and before posting here I tried to disable it, but it kept showing up. I restarted my computer and tried it again, and now the plugin is disabled and it appears after my first few attempts at saving, creating new scenes, and deleting geometry it hasn’t frozen again (which it was with all of those actions).
